NHRCK Host Academic Seminar in Commemoration of Publication of ICTs and Human Rights Report

The National Human Rights Commission of Korea (NHRCK), the Korea Internet Law Association and the Comparative Law Research Institute of the Dongguk University jointly held an academic seminar commemorating the publication of the report on the Information and Communications Technologies (ICTs) and Human Rights at the Dongguk University on June 14, 2003.

 

 

The Seminar, which came five months after the NHRCK’s publication of the world’s very first report on the ICTs and human rights in January 2013, aimed to discuss a wide range of issues in the ICTs and human rights arena in a comprehensive manner.

 

Specific issues discussed at the seminar are as follows:

 

 

△ Right to information privacy
- Communications surveillance such as CCTVs, SNS, digging up of personal information via SNS, right to be forgotten

 

△ Freedom of anonymous speech
- Limitation of the restriction on freedom of anonymous speech
Ex) controversies over the so-called Ilbe, a social website in Korea 

 

△ Right of access to information and the right to enjoyment of information
- Public information disclosure system
- Internet access
- Copyright
- Network neutrality

 

△ ICT policies
